Changesets: bareos

bareos-16.2 ca944e3b

2016-08-19 20:12

joergs

Ported: N/A

Details Diff
configure add: deny adding a director resource

Only a single director resource is allowed per director.
mod - src/dird/dird_conf.c Diff File
mod - src/dird/ua_configure.c Diff File
mod - src/lib/parse_conf.c Diff File

bareos-16.2 c33d2fd6

2016-08-19 19:35

mvwieringen

Ported: N/A

Details Diff
fdplugins: Fix some plugin problems.

We should return a boolean from trigger_plugin_event()
and not a bRC value. When rc is non null always set
a proper bRC value that way.
mod - src/filed/fd_plugins.c Diff File

master cae6abeb

2016-08-19 19:32

mvwieringen

Ported: N/A

Details Diff
Merge branch 'bareos-16.2'
mod - src/dird/ua.h Diff File
mod - src/dird/ua_input.c Diff File
mod - src/dird/ua_run.c Diff File
mod - src/findlib/find_one.c Diff File

master 183fa094

2016-08-19 19:32

mvwieringen

Ported: N/A

Details Diff
Merge branch 'bareos-15.2' into bareos-16.2
mod - src/dird/ua.h Diff File
mod - src/dird/ua_input.c Diff File
mod - src/dird/ua_run.c Diff File
mod - src/findlib/find_one.c Diff File

master 8063e757

2016-08-19 11:31

mvwieringen

Ported: N/A

Details Diff
dird: Resource edits get lost depending on order

When a user gives an explicit pool to use we should not apply any pool
overrides anymore.

Fixes 0000689: Interactive job modification not working as expected,
resource edits get lost depending on mod order
Affected Issues
0000689
mod - src/dird/ua.h Diff File
mod - src/dird/ua_run.c Diff File

bareos-16.2 cb52b40d

2016-08-18 17:35

joergs

Ported: N/A

Details Diff
added "configure export client=<client>" command

Let the Bareos Director write the corresponding bareos-fd director
resource for a configured client to
<CONFIGDIR>/bareos-dir-export/client/<clientname>/bareos-fd.d/director/<directorname>.conf
mod - src/dird/dird_conf.c Diff File
mod - src/dird/ua_configure.c Diff File

bareos-16.2 ef0e212d

2016-08-18 15:17

joergs

Ported: N/A

Details Diff
Fix file name for exported resources

An exported bareos-fd director resource needs to have the name of the
director, and not of the client, for which it is generated.

Also package the directory used for exporting client resources:
/etc/bareos/bareos-dir-export/client/
mod - debian/bareos-director.dirs Diff File
mod - src/dird/Makefile.in Diff File
mod - src/dird/ua_configure.c Diff File

master e3175dc8

2016-08-15 14:45

joergs

Ported: N/A

Details Diff
Director console: fixes subcommand prompt ordering

In some cases, subcommand prompts have not been displayed in the right
order. This patch fixes this.
mod - src/dird/ua_input.c Diff File

bareos-15.2 df4a2475

2016-08-12 21:10

sobolev_es


Committer: mvwieringen

Ported: N/A

Details Diff
select files by size feature - ssize_t overflow for 32 bits

Integer overflow in src/findlib/find_one.c:check_size_matching()
ssize_t in 32-bit linux is int_32.

Signed-off-by: Marco van Wieringen <marco.van.wieringen@bareos.com>
Affected Issues
0000688
mod - src/findlib/find_one.c Diff File

master f4784a7d

2016-08-12 18:21

mvwieringen

Ported: N/A

Details Diff
Merge branch 'bareos-16.2'
mod - src/dird/stats.c Diff File
mod - src/stored/Makefile.in Diff File
mod - src/stored/status.c Diff File

master 5a4c362f

2016-08-12 18:21

mvwieringen

Ported: N/A

Details Diff
Merge branch 'bareos-15.2' into bareos-16.2
mod - src/dird/stats.c Diff File
mod - src/stored/Makefile.in Diff File
mod - src/stored/status.c Diff File

master 4c8c38f7

2016-08-12 11:00

Marco van Wieringen

Ported: N/A

Details Diff
Merge branch 'bareos-16.2'
mod - config/autoload/global.php Diff File
mod - install/directors.ini Diff File
mod - module/Client/src/Client/Model/ClientModel.php Diff File
mod - vendor/Bareos/library/Bareos/BSock/BareosBSock.php Diff File

master efce5d71

2016-08-11 16:52

mvwieringen

Ported: N/A

Details Diff
Fix boolean inversion.
mod - src/dird/stats.c Diff File

master 283689aa

2016-08-10 14:47

Frank Bergkemper

Ported: N/A

Details Diff
Clients: Enable/Disable state

Just display the action button (enable or disable) which is needed according to the clients
state. Also display the clients state labeled in a separate column.
mod - module/Client/src/Client/Controller/ClientController.php Diff File
mod - module/Client/src/Client/Model/ClientModel.php Diff File
mod - module/Client/view/client/client/index.phtml Diff File

master 7a5cd0b5

2016-08-09 19:42

Frank Bergkemper

Ported: N/A

Details Diff
Jobs: Enable/Disable state

Just display the action button which is needed according to the jobs
state. Also display the jobs state labeled in a separate column.
mod - module/Job/view/job/job/actions.phtml Diff File

master 0989fa8a

2016-08-09 18:08

Frank Bergkemper

Ported: N/A

Details Diff
Schedules: Enable/Disable state

Just display the action button which is needed according to the schedules
state. Also display the schedule state labeled in a separate column.
mod - module/Schedule/view/schedule/schedule/index.phtml Diff File

master eab9bb05

2016-08-08 22:44

Marco van Wieringen

Ported: N/A

Details Diff
Use new current and enabled options to llist jobs last
mod - module/Job/src/Job/Model/JobModel.php Diff File

master 820ee09c

2016-08-08 22:44

Marco van Wieringen

Ported: N/A

Details Diff
Use new current command to llist clients
mod - module/Client/src/Client/Model/ClientModel.php Diff File

master 27abc4dc

2016-08-08 22:44

Marco van Wieringen

Ported: N/A

Details Diff
Only send catalog when an explicit catalog is set for a director.
mod - config/autoload/global.php Diff File
mod - install/directors.ini Diff File
mod - vendor/Bareos/library/Bareos/BSock/BareosBSock.php Diff File

master 284c3fe1

2016-08-08 22:44

Marco van Wieringen

Ported: N/A

Details Diff
Refactor getClientBackups method.

Fix permutations and typo introduced in previous refactoring.
mod - module/Client/src/Client/Model/ClientModel.php Diff File

master d28da49d

2016-08-08 22:44

Marco van Wieringen


Committer: Frank Bergkemper

Ported: N/A

Details Diff
Only send catalog when an explicit catalog is set for a director.
mod - config/autoload/global.php Diff File
mod - install/directors.ini Diff File
mod - vendor/Bareos/library/Bareos/BSock/BareosBSock.php Diff File

master 3154f1df

2016-08-08 22:44

Marco van Wieringen


Committer: Frank Bergkemper

Ported: N/A

Details Diff
Refactor getClientBackups method.

Fix permutations and typo introduced in previous refactoring.
mod - module/Client/src/Client/Model/ClientModel.php Diff File

master ea9d5333

2016-08-08 12:19

mvwieringen

Ported: N/A

Details Diff
stored: Fix problem with static linking rados striper support.
mod - src/stored/Makefile.in Diff File

master 71897c68

2016-08-08 12:19

mvwieringen

Ported: N/A

Details Diff
stored: Add corner case check for showing devices.

Even when a drive is part of an autochanger we still need to
see if we are not requested to list an explicit device name.
e.g. this happens when people address one particular device in
a autochanger via its own storage definition.
mod - src/stored/status.c Diff File

master ba0e9630

2016-08-04 17:01

mvwieringen

Ported: N/A

Details Diff
Merge branch 'bareos-16.2'
mod - src/defaultconfigs/bareos-dir.d/messages/Standard.conf.in Diff File
mod - src/defaultconfigs/bareos-fd.d/messages/Standard.conf Diff File
mod - src/dird/consolidate.c Diff File
mod - src/dird/dird_conf.c Diff File
mod - src/dird/dird_conf.h Diff File
mod - src/dird/jobq.c Diff File
mod - src/lib/parse_conf.h Diff File
 First  Prev  1 2 3 ... 60 ... 120 ... 180 ... 240 ... 300 ... 360 ... 420 ... 452 453 454 455 456 457 458 ... 480 ... 540 ... 600 ... 613 614 615  Next  Last